Understanding Hugger Ceiling Fans: Close to the Ceiling, Close to Perfection

Hugger ceiling fans are designed to mount incredibly close to the ceiling, minimizing the distance between the blades and the ceiling itself. This makes them perfect for rooms with low ceilings, where a standard ceiling fan might feel too bulky or even hit your head! Their compact design doesn't compromise on air circulation; they're surprisingly efficient at moving air, especially in smaller spaces.

Key Advantages of Hugger Ceiling Fans:

  • Ideal for Low Ceilings: The primary benefit is their ability to function effectively in rooms with limited ceiling height.
  • Space-Saving Design: They take up minimal vertical space, maximizing the feeling of openness in smaller rooms.
  • Efficient Air Circulation: Despite their compact size, many models provide excellent air circulation.
  • Stylish Options: Hugger fans are available in various styles to complement any décor.

Choosing the Right Remote Control Hugger Ceiling Fan: Key Factors to Consider

Selecting the perfect remote control hugger ceiling fan involves considering several crucial factors:

1. Room Size and Ceiling Height:

  • Measure your ceiling height carefully. Ensure the chosen fan's clearance meets safety guidelines.
  • Consider the room's square footage. A larger room might require a fan with a larger blade span for optimal air circulation.

2. Blade Size and Design:

  • Blade size impacts airflow. Larger blades generally move more air, but may not be suitable for all low ceiling spaces.
  • Blade material and design affect noise levels and aesthetics. Consider options that align with your style preferences.

3. Motor Type and Power:

  • DC motors are generally quieter and more energy-efficient than AC motors.
  • Check the airflow rating (CFM) to ensure adequate air movement for your room size.

4. Remote Control Features:

  • Look for features like multiple speeds, reverse function (for both summer and winter use), and dimming options (if available).
  • Consider the range and reliability of the remote control.

5. Style and Finish:

  • Choose a style that complements your room's décor. Hugger fans come in various finishes, including brushed nickel, oil-rubbed bronze, and white.
